National Road Safety Week – move over, slow down campaign

The Queensland Police Service is supporting a new road safety campaign as part of National Road Safety Week (NRSW) 2019. “Move over, slow down” is a targeted social media and outdoor road safety campaign reminding drivers to behave safely when passing roadside emergency responders and their vehicles.
